As you might expect, we've been trawling through piles of things and trying to work out what to keep, and what should have been thrown since it had had at least two decades to come in handy. Random photos are random and contain scenes I don't remember.

entertainment

Early 80s. Probably 83-84. Note cheap guitars, skronky monosynth, the Computing Toady issue containing the multi-platform graphical (for Commodore and MZ80K values of same) adventure, C64 hacking manual, Maplin book and lord knows what other technical docs. We don't talk about the microphone case.

lomac

I don't know what became of the Logical Machine Corporation, or indeed what that particular machine was called. There was a bigger one with two drives called a Tina. I dragged the thing home from then-work, where I was a bench technician, to write a spares-control/inventory system over the Christmas holiday. From what I remember it worked quite well. The windowsill is filled with components and random bits of circuitry. The desk belonged to dad. Since it now belongs to me, I am finally allowed to rifle through the drawers where there are many Interesting Things.
